Stuttgart’s midfielder Wataru Endo is reportedly scheduled for a medical with Liverpool today, as he moves closer to completing a €19 million transfer to Anfield.

Share:

Wataru Endo, is reportedly on the brink of a significant move to English giants Liverpool. In what could be a transformative step for his career, the Japanese international is said to be undergoing a medical examination today, paving the way for a proposed €19 million transfer to Anfield.

While Endo’s name might not be the flashiest among the Reds’ summer transfer targets, his potential arrival carries substantial implications. With prominent pursuits of players such as Moises Caicedo and Romeo Lavia yielding no fruition, it appears that Liverpool’s hunt for reinforcement in the defensive midfield position might finally be culminating with Endo’s arrival.

The void left by the notable departures of Jordan Henderson and Fabinho this summer has accentuated the club’s need to bolster its midfield options. Notably, David Ornstein of The Athletic has hinted at an imminent medical assessment, suggesting that the finer details of this transfer are being swiftly ironed out.

Endo’s impending move holds intriguing promise. Despite operating somewhat under the radar during the current transfer window, the bargain nature of his acquisition might just endear him to the Liverpool faithful. As the deal nears finalization, anticipation mounts among supporters who are hopeful that this relatively unheralded signing could prove to be a masterstroke for the club in the long run.
